Liverpool keeper Pepe Reina plays down rumors of him returning to Barcelona.

The Spaniard started his career at Camp Nou but went to Villarreal in 2002. He is said to be Tito Vilanova’s top man to replace Victor Valdes for the new 2013-14 season.

Barcelona’s current number one keeper has confirmed that he will not sign an extension with the La Liga champions and is looking for a new challenge after spending his whole professional life with the club.

This has sparked news about a possible return of Reina to Spain, but the 30-year-old revealed that he is happy with his life at Anfield.

“I have three more years with Liverpool. I’m satisfied, comfortable and my family are very happy,” the goalkeeper revealed.

“I don’t know if there has been contact between the clubs or with my agent. At the moment I don’t think there’s anything serious.”

However, Reina claims he does not have any ill feelings toward the Catalan club, despite being sold early in his career.

“The years I was at Barcelona were very good, I don’t have any bad feelings about not succeeding there. I played more than 50 games when I was less than 20 – it helped me grow a lot,” Reina continued.
